Forest structure predicts species richness and functional diversity in Amazonian mixed-species bird flocks

Background

Secondary forests between forest fragments are valuable sources of biodiversity during the regeneration process. In the Brazilian Amazon, understory birds are often an indicator of forest regeneration and overall health. Functional diversity is an important component of ecosystem health and services, yet little is known about the role it plays in the return of mixed-species bird flocks.

Removing climbers more than doubles tree growth and biomass in degraded tropical forests

Background

Tree climbing plants such as lianas are known to inhibit forest recovery by outcompeting trees after disturbances. The removal of climbers is recognized as a viable forest restoration management practice, however no best practices are established yet due to lack of research repetition and synthesis.

Goals and Methods

The authors conduct a literature review on climber removal studies in tropical forests in order to quantify removal efficacy for promoting tree growth and increasing biomass.

Linking disturbance history to current forest structure to assess the impact of disturbances in tropical dry forests

Background

Tropical dry forests are given less attention in studies compared to tropical humid forests, but they still experience high levels of disturbance, both natural and human-made. These disturbances heavily alter the characteristics of valuable remaining forest structures. There are gaps in knowledge about how the timing and type of disturbance affects forest structure in seasonally dry tropical forests.

Spatial density patterns of herbivore response to seasonal dynamics in the tropical deciduous forest of central India

Background

Strong seasonality of dry tropical forests causes variations in vegetation and therefore food resources for animals. This study investigates the seasonal distribution patterns between summer and winter of four ungulate species (Rusa unicolor, Axis axis, Bocephalus tragocamelus, and Sus scrofa) in the Panna Tiger Reserve in India. Ungulates tend to gravitate towards areas that are cooler with more vegetation, and at higher elevations.

Out of steady state: Tracking canopy gap dynamics across Brazilian Amazon

Background

Canopy gaps are a regular characteristic of natural or anthropogenic disturbance in forested landscapes. Gap-creating disturbances often result in a forest mosaic with patches of varying successional stages. Many species in tropical forests depend on these canopy gaps for regeneration. Field monitoring of canopy gaps can be difficult due to time constraints and plot size, making tropical gap dynamics an understudied topic.

Conservation Finance: A Framework

Background

The authors define conservation finance as “mechanisms and strategies that generate, manage, and deploy financial resources and align incentives to achieve nature conservation outcomes.” Governments are the largest contributors to conservation finance resources, and common mechanisms include grants, subsidies, and fiscal transfers, among others.

Forty years of community-based forestry: A review of its extent and effectiveness

Background

This report assesses the effectiveness of community-based forestry (CBF) over the past 40 years. Governments have been implementing programs such as participatory conservation, joint forest management, community forestry with partial or full devolution, and private ownership over several decades, and the authors assess the biophysical and social impacts of these programs, and outline the key lessons learnt during this time.

Money for Nothing? A Call for Empirical Evaluation of Biodiversity Conservation Investments

Background

The authors assert that while the ecological aspects of conservation efforts are highly investigated and supported by empirical evidence, the policy aspects are not. In response, they argue that conservation policy measures must adopt program evaluation methods that would allow one to determine if intervention would be viable.

A Guide to Selecting Ecosystem Service Models for Decision-Making: Lessons from Sub-Saharan Africa

Background

Ecosystem services provide critical resources that support human well-being; therefore, managing for them is vital. This report suggests that modeling may be an effective means of informing management when data is lacking, a problem that many developing countries experience.
